On Sale Add to Cart Quick view ECCOLALIA RAMA LAMA SPAIN MSRP: Now: $30.79 Was: $34.99 With their "wall of fuzz" - the Swedish duo Nova Blast have a strange way of finding their way into the heart of different audiences. Whether it has been by opening for acclaimed lo-fi electro acts...